D. A. Damassa is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Reproductive Medicine and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, D. A. Damassa has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 2.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, 21 papers in Reproductive Medicine and 11 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in D. A. Damassa’s work include Hormonal and reproductive studies (26 papers), Hypothalamic control of reproductive hormones (16 papers) and Bat Biology and Ecology Studies (11 papers). D. A. Damassa is often cited by papers focused on Hormonal and reproductive studies (26 papers), Hypothalamic control of reproductive hormones (16 papers) and Bat Biology and Ecology Studies (11 papers). D. A. Damassa collaborates with scholars based in United States. D. A. Damassa's co-authors include A. W. Gustafson, Joan C. King, Erla R. Smith, Julian M. Davidson and Gary G. Kwiecinski and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, JNCI Journal of the National Cancer Institute and Brain Research.
